Subject: Key rotation — Tidewatch widget backend

Hi folks, quick heads-up for whoever's on call this week: we rotated the service key the Tidewatch tide-table widget uses to pull predictions from the Moonpull forecast service. The old key dies Friday at noon. If the widget starts showing stale tables, swap in the new key and redeploy. Here's the replacement key for the on-call config.

service key, kawig-hahaf: zpat4_JspY

Handover — weekly cash-box run, Hallervik depot. Marta, the locked box from the front office is staged on shelf B as usual, sealed with two tamper strips this week because last Friday's seal looked scuffed. Count sheet is inside the lid pouch, signed by Odran before close. The Ferntide courier arrives mid-morning; verify the van placard before releasing anything, and log the pickup time in the red binder. The hand-over phrase for the courier is below.

handover note for yagef-bagep: the drudor pelius courier leaves the kasdor zorvan norir ledger at gate 8016 under passcode 755406

Action item: The Relayn deploy-status bot silently dropped updates when the pipeline API paginated results, so responders believed a rollback had completed when it had not. We will add pagination handling, a staleness banner, and an integration test. Until merged, verify deploy state directly in the pipeline console, documented at the page below.

runbook for kahop-kajop: https://rundeck.ordinio.test/display/secrets/pipeline/issue/pages/repo/browse/e5732776e07d1285107e5aeb